Title
A resolution amending Resolution No. 5802 to recognize and approve a form of bond proposition amended to comply with State Bond Commission rules.
Body
WHEREAS, this Parish Council by Resolution No. 5802 approved the holding of an election on April 30, 2011 in Hospital Service District No. 1 of the Parish of St. Charles, State of Louisiana, at which election there will be submitted two propositions to the electorates; and
WHEREAS, in order to comply with the rules of the State Bond Commission, it is necessary to change the wording of the Hospital Service District Bond Proposition so that the words "to the amount of " are changed to "not exceeding" in both the summary and body of the proposition.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Parish Council of the Parish of St. Charles, State of Louisiana, acting as the governing authority of said Parish, that:
SECTION 1. Resolution No. 5802 is hereby amended so that the form of the Hospital District Bond Proposition appearing in Section 1 thereof is worded as follows:
HOSPITAL DISTRICT BOND PROPOSITION
Summary: Authority for Hospital Service District No. 1 to issue not exceeding $3,000,000 of not exceeding 20-year General Obligation Bonds for the purpose of purchasing, acquiring and constructing lands, buildings, machinery, equipment, and furnishings, including both real and personal property, to be used in providing hospital facilities to the district, said bonds to be general obligations of said Hospital Service District and to be payable from ad valorem taxes.
Shall Hospital Service District No. 1 of the Parish of St. Charles, State of Louisiana, incur debt and issue bonds to an amount not to exceed Three Million Dollars ($3,000,000), to not exceed twenty (20) years from the date thereof, with interest at a rate not exceeding nine per centum (9%) per annum, for the purpose of purchasing, acquiring and constructing lands, buildings, machinery, equipment and furnishings, including both real and personal property, to be used in providing hospital facilities to the District, title to which shall be in the public, which bonds will be general obligations of the District and will be payable from ad valorem taxes to be levied and collected in the manner provided by Article VI, Section 33 of the Constitution of the State of Louisiana of 1974 and statutory authority supplemental thereto, with an estimated .18 increase in the millage rate to be levied in the first year of issue above the 2.46 mills currently being levied to pay General Obligation Bonds of the District?
SECTION 2. Except as provided above, Resolution No. 5802 and the approvals granted thereby are hereby ratified and affirmed.
